I'm very happy for the fact that D&D 2024 is bringing back some attention to the old school bastions (it doesn't matter whether the name was the same or not): building a place, attracting followers, managing the place, dividing the PC's time and focus between "playing Civilization" and going adventuring. That was a really pleasant part of D&D in the 70s and 80s. The C (Companion) book from BECMI was focused on that, and did it very well. It did not follow 100% of what oD&D said, and that was a good thing in my opinion, since we could choose the best of both worlds. Also, in the 90s, Birthright came, and it was great at expanding those Kingdom rules, but unfortunately did not last long. Long story short, the new Bastion rules build on the ones mentioned above, but mixing those with 5e flavour. Such an interesting mixture! I hope you do make a video on that, Luke. Warm regards, V
